How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Sherwood Forest?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Sherwood Forest Studio Apartments | $2,351 | $2,000 | $2,555 |
Sherwood Forest 1 Bedroom Apartments | $3,369 | $1,000 | $4,957 |
| Sherwood Forest 2 Bedroom Apartments | $4,140 | $2,850 | $5,984 |
| Sherwood Forest 3 Bedroom Apartments | $5,292 | $3,800 | $9,500 |
| Sherwood Forest 4 Bedroom Apartments | $8,540 | $5,600 | $10,000+ |

Frequently Asked Questions about 1 Bedroom Sherwood Forest Apartments
How much is the average rent for a 1 Bedroom Sherwood Forest Apartment?
The average rent for a 1 Bedroom Apartment in Sherwood Forest is $3,369.
What is the largest available 1 Bedroom Sherwood Forest Apartment for rent?
Today's apartment with the most square footage in Sherwood Forest is a 769 square feet unit starting from $2,745 at Parkmerced Apartments.
What is the average size for Sherwood Forest 1 Bedroom Apartments for rent?
The average size for a 1 Bedroom rental in Sherwood Forest is currently 435 sq ft.
